
Manhunt Underway in Jammu and Kashmir After Killing of Army Officers and Police Official.
A significant manhunt is currently in progress in Jammu and Kashmir to locate and apprehend the terrorists responsible for the ambush-style killings of two army officers and a deputy superintendent of police. Security forces, including elite units and specialized equipment, are engaged in the operation to prevent the terrorists from escaping. This incident has occurred at a time when terrorist activities in the region have been on the decline.
Targeted Attack on Security Personnel
The attack took place in Anantnag district, where Colonel Manpreet Singh, Major Ashish Dhonchak (both from 19 Rashtriya Rifles), and DSP Humayun Muzamil Bhat were killed in a gunfight while leading teams in pursuit of terrorists hidden in concealed positions in the dense Garol forest at Kokernag. Two soldiers were also injured in the attack.
Swift and Coordinated Response
Security forces quickly responded to the situation, with reinforcements brought in. The operation involves a coordinated effort between the army and the Jammu and Kashmir Police, employing modern surveillance equipment, dog squads, jammers, and drones to track down the terrorists.
Identification of Terrorists and Tightening the Noose
The operation has successfully identified two Lashkar-e-Taiba terrorists, including one known as Uzair Khan, who has risen through the ranks quickly, earning the status of a “commander.” Security forces have sealed off all likely escape routes, and assault teams are focusing on neutralizing potential terrorist hideouts.

Security Situation in Jammu and Kashmir
The incident comes during a period when the region had been experiencing a relative calm. Data presented in Parliament indicated a decline in terrorist-initiated incidents and encounters in Jammu and Kashmir in 2022 compared to previous years. However, the recent attacks serve as a stark reminder of the ever-present dangers faced by security personnel in the region.
